2 votos

¿Gestión_de_clips parece borrar el shapefile?

Tenemos un código python que recorta un shapefile muy grande para su posterior procesamiento.

Podemos ver que el proceso crea todos los archivos de salida, pero luego, justo cuando el proceso está terminando, se borran.

Los únicos archivos que quedan son los SBN, SBX y XML. ¿Qué diablos está pasando?

Podemos ejecutar el proceso sin problemas dentro de ArcMap, pero el código de Python parece estar estropeando algo.

Aquí está el código:

# Check out any necessary licenses
arcpy.CheckOutExtension("3D")

Sage4ac = "D:\\DPerret\\GIS\\Base_Data\\SagebrushData\\SageLeks\\Sagebursh.gdb\\Poly\\Sage4ac"

# Process: Clip Sage
arcpy.Clip_analysis(aoi, Sage4ac, tempPath + "sageclip.shp", "")

0voto

UnkwnTech Puntos 21942

Mi sospecha es que Clip se está saliendo cuando el shapefile que intenta escribir alcanza el límite de tamaño de 2Gb.

Sería bueno confirmar, mediante el uso de Copy As Python Snippet, que está utilizando precisamente las mismas entradas y salidas cuando esto funciona en ArcMap y parece que no desde ArcPy.

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X